JAMES ROBERT JOHNSON
is honored on Panel 12E, Row 79 of
the Vietnam Veterans Memorial.

Full Name: JAMES ROBERT JOHNSON
Wall Name: JAMES R JOHNSON
Date of Birth: 6/16/1943
Date of Casualty: 11/16/1966
Home of Record: NORFOLK
County of Record: CITY OF NORFOLK
State: VA
Branch of Service: ARMY
Rank: 1LT
Casualty Country: SOUTH VIETNAM
Casualty Province: PR & MR UNKNOWN
